
About this product
A lightweight serum suspension containing 10% azelaic acid, designed to address redness, hyperpigmentation, and congestion.

✓Approved · 73%What the gurus are saying
Gurus praise the product's efficacy for hyperpigmentation, acne marks, and rosacea at a budget price, and consistently highlight its compatibility with other actives. A recent reformulation appears to have resolved the historic texture complaint of grittiness and pilling that deterred past users. The main divide is texture tolerance: some find it grainy or sandpapery, while others report it now glides on smoothly. Overall sentiment is strongly positive, with repeated endorsements for sensitive skin and as a versatile treatment option.

Full ingredients
Aqua (Water), Isodecyl Neopentanoate, Dimethicone, Azelaic Acid 10.0%, Dimethicone/Bis-Isobutyl PPG-20 Crosspolymer, Dimethyl Isosorbide, Hydroxyethyl Acrylate/Sodium Acryloyldimethyl Taurate Copolymer, Polysilicone-11, Isohexadecane, Tocopherol, Trisodium Ethylenediamine Disuccinate, Isoceteth-20, Polysorbate 60, Triethanolamine, Ethoxydiglycol, Phenoxyethanol, Chlorphenesin
